Has anyone changed out rubicon wheels for different wheels, but used the stock mudders for time being. If so can u post some pics and details of wheels.
I am trying to do things in steps. Am planning on doing the TF levening kit for now and changing out the wheels to the ProComp 8089 17x8 wheels but am thinking about using the stock tires, but dont know if they will work. Then later changing out to 33's or 35's once the wife says ok..

Yes, they should work. The stock BFG MT KMs will work just fine on any wheel, and while most people upgrade the tires first, there's nothing wrong with upgrading the wheels first. The stock tires are a little more narrow than most people like, but a 17x8 should fit them fine.
My camera is out of commission so I can't do any pics,but I do have the Rubi BFGs on aftermarket wheels.
I have 17x8 Ultra Goliaths with the BFGs. I actually looked for local takeoffs for a bit but then ordered the BFGs from Discount tire.
I think the BFGs are a good match for a jeep at stock height or leveling kit. I don't like the look of the largest tires that can be crammed under the fender flares.
